Advertisement

STM32F1搭配ST7735和ITL9163B的8位并口驱动(20针)

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本项目介绍如何使用STM32F1微控制器通过8位并行接口连接ST7735液晶屏与ITL9163B触摸屏,实现低成本、高性能的嵌入式人机交互界面设计。 1.8寸ST7735 ITL9163B TFT 8位并口驱动keil项目;STM32F103R8 MCU 液晶屏数据线接线: 本模块默认的数据总线类型为8位并行模式,具体接法如下: - 液晶屏LCD_D0对应单片机PC0 - 液晶屏LCD_D1对应单片机PC1 - 液晶屏LCD_D2对应单片机PC2 - 液晶屏LCD_D3对应单片机PC3 - 液晶屏LCD_D4对应单片机PC4 - 液晶屏LCD_D5对应单片机PC5 - 液晶屏LCD_D6对应单片机PC6 - 液晶屏LCD_D7对应单片机PC7 液晶屏控制线接法: - LCD_RST 接PB4 (复位信号) - LCD_CS 接PB3 (片选信号) - LCD_RS 接PB5 (寄存器/数据选择信号)

全部评论 (0)

还没有任何评论哟~
客服
客服
  • STM32F1ST7735ITL9163B820
    优质
    本项目介绍如何使用STM32F1微控制器通过8位并行接口连接ST7735液晶屏与ITL9163B触摸屏,实现低成本、高性能的嵌入式人机交互界面设计。 1.8寸ST7735 ITL9163B TFT 8位并口驱动keil项目;STM32F103R8 MCU 液晶屏数据线接线: 本模块默认的数据总线类型为8位并行模式,具体接法如下: - 液晶屏LCD_D0对应单片机PC0 - 液晶屏LCD_D1对应单片机PC1 - 液晶屏LCD_D2对应单片机PC2 - 液晶屏LCD_D3对应单片机PC3 - 液晶屏LCD_D4对应单片机PC4 - 液晶屏LCD_D5对应单片机PC5 - 液晶屏LCD_D6对应单片机PC6 - 液晶屏LCD_D7对应单片机PC7 液晶屏控制线接法: - LCD_RST 接PB4 (复位信号) - LCD_CS 接PB3 (片选信号) - LCD_RS 接PB5 (寄存器/数据选择信号)
  • ILI9342 8-16
    优质
    本驱动程序为ILI9342 TFT LCD控制器提供8位或16位并行接口支持,适用于各类嵌入式系统中的图形显示应用。 TFT LCD 芯片 ILI9342 驱动包括并口8位和16位驱动,显示成功,并且界面良好。
  • 51ST7735.zip_C51 ST7735_ST7735 串_ST7735_c51 st7735
    优质
    这是一个C51单片机使用的ST7735液晶屏驱动代码包,适用于ST7735串口通信。包含了详细的配置和使用说明文档,帮助开发者快速上手实现屏幕显示功能。 ST7735驱动IC的SPI串口4线驱动代码可以用于实现屏幕显示功能。此代码通过SPI接口与显示屏进行通信,利用四条信号线(SCLK、DIN、DC和RST)来控制数据传输及命令选择等操作。在编写或使用此类驱动时,请确保正确配置引脚并遵循相关硬件手册以获得最佳效果。
  • STM32F1OPT3001光传感器程序
    优质
    本项目提供了一个详细的驱动程序示例,用于在STM32F1微控制器平台上操作OPT3001数字环境光线传感器。通过该驱动程序,开发者可以轻松地读取光照强度数据,并根据需要调整代码以适应不同的应用场景和需求。 使用STM32F103单片机读取OPT3001光传感器的数据的驱动程序。
  • 对HLK-806与HLK801ST7789 16
    优质
    本简介聚焦于HLK-806和HLK801芯片在使用ST7789显示芯片时,实现高效稳定的16位并行接口驱动技术。该方案为嵌入式系统提供卓越的图形处理性能与低功耗特性,适合多种应用场景需求。 适用于HLK-806和HLK801的ST7789 16位并口驱动提供了一种有效的显示控制方式,能够满足多种应用需求。此驱动程序设计旨在优化性能,并兼容上述硬件平台,为开发者提供了灵活且高效的图形输出解决方案。
  • ST7735S芯片LCD彩色屏及SPI接
    优质
    本产品为ST7735S驱动芯片与八针LCD彩色显示屏结合,通过SPI接口实现高效数据传输,适用于便携式设备和嵌入式系统中。 标题中的“八针LCD彩色屏 ST7735S驱动芯片 SPI接口”涉及的是嵌入式系统中的显示技术,特别是微控制器与LCD显示屏的交互。这里我们主要讨论以下几个知识点: 1. **八针LCD彩色屏**:这通常指的是使用八条引脚连接的液晶显示器,这种屏幕通常用于小型嵌入式设备或物联网设备中,因为它们占用空间小,功耗低,并且能够提供彩色显示功能。由于接口线数有限制(仅有八根),这类显示屏适合于简单的应用。 2. **ST7735S驱动芯片**:这是意法半导体生产的一款用于TFT LCD屏幕的控制器和驱动器。该芯片具备控制像素阵列、设置刷新率以及处理颜色等所有必要功能,支持SPI通信协议,可以方便地与微控制器(如Arduino或Raspberry Pi)连接。 3. **SPI接口**:这是一种同步串行接口标准,用于在主设备(例如微控制器)和从属外设之间进行数据传输。它通常使用四根信号线来实现全双工通信——包括时钟线、选择线以及两条数据线路(一条为主输出/从机输入,另一条为主输入/从机输出)。SPI接口允许快速的数据交换,并且只需少量的引脚即可完成复杂的通讯任务。 在实际应用中,开发人员需要编写专门用于控制ST7735S芯片的驱动程序,以设置显示模式、调整亮度及颜色等参数。这些操作通常通过微控制器上的固件或软件实现(例如使用C语言)。项目文件夹中的`.uvprojx`可能是Keil μVision项目的配置文件;而其他如`.uvguix`和`.uvoptx`可能包含GUI设置与编译优化选项。目录内的“Library”、“Objects”中存放了库文件及编译对象,而DebugConfig、Start则关联到调试信息以及程序启动的设定。 对于电子竞赛(如23年电赛E题附加题)来说,这样的LCD彩色屏和SPI接口组合可以用于创建创新的数据可视化展示平台。参赛者需要具备SPI通信协议的理解能力、ST7735S驱动芯片的应用技能及对LCD屏幕像素与色彩处理的掌握才能有效地使用这些硬件资源完成项目任务。
  • STM32L496RGT6AD7606及USB串,使用USART1(PA9-PA10)
    优质
    本项目基于STM32L496RGT6微控制器,结合AD7606高速模数转换器,并采用并行接口和USB转串口通信技术,通过USART1实现数据传输。 推荐AN706模块,适用于工程师和学生使用。该模块可以实现并口驱动USB打印,并支持串口打印功能。此外,它还配备了一个8M的单片机外部晶振以及一个±10V的7位半电压表。
  • STM32F1 ST7735 TFT Demo.zip
    优质
    这是一个包含STM32F1系列微控制器与ST7735驱动IC配合使用的TFT液晶显示演示项目的压缩包。 ## 硬件平台 1. 野火STM32F103ZET6 霸道V2开发板 2. 正点原子F1系列开发板 3. STM32F103ZET6核心板 4. ST7735 TFT液晶显示屏
  • STM3224打印机源代码
    优质
    本项目提供了一套用于STM32微控制器控制24针打印机的完整源代码,涵盖并行接口与串行接口两种通信方式,适用于需要高精度打印输出的应用场景。 STM32并口驱动打印机和串口驱动打印机的源代码可以用于相关项目的开发和学习。这些代码帮助开发者更好地理解如何通过不同的接口与外部设备进行通信,并提供了实现的具体示例。对于需要使用STM32微控制器来控制打印操作的研究人员或工程师来说,这类资源非常有用。
  • STM32F1L6205H桥式步进电机控制.rar
    优质
    本资源包含基于STM32F1系列微控制器与L6205H H桥芯片实现步进电机控制的设计文档和代码,适用于工业自动化及机器人领域。 STM32F1步进电机L6205H桥驱动控制.rar